==Origin==
==Origin==
[[File:Triforce.png|thumb|left|100px|The three pieces of the Triforce.]]
This move is unique to the ''{{b|Super Smash Bros.|series}}'' series. However, it is similar to the final blow performed against [[Ganondorf|Ganon]] during the final boss battle in ''[[The Legend of Zelda: Ocarina of Time]]''. In this game, once Ganon has been damaged enough, he falls down and [[Princess Zelda|Zelda]] uses her magic to paralyze him, leaving him vulnerable to a final strike, which consists of three slashing attacks before Link pierces through him with his sword.
